I had a daytona 600 for 3 years before the blade. I bought it without a test ride in Jan 2011, ran it in while there was ice and snow and grime and mud on the road. It's so confidence inspiring and smooth, and dare i say it, easier to ride than the 600, especially round town due to the torque. It felt slower as it's so smooth, until you look down and you`re doing warp factor 9 mr sulu. No stamping through the gearbox and hitting 15k revs everywhere as the low down power is fantastic as is the midrange. Handles like a 600 once you get the sussy sorted and is just a fantastic bike. Weight is not a problem as it's so compact, you'll love it!
